Siding replacement services involve removing existing exterior siding and installing new materials to improve the appearance, durability,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ying structure,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the new siding to ensure a secure fit. Homeowners often seek this service when their current siding has become damaged, outdated, or no longer provides adequate protection against the elements. A professional siding replacement can enhance the curb appeal of a home while also helping to prevent issues like leaks, drafts, and moisture intrusion.
Many common problems can signal the need for siding replacement. Cracked, warped, or rotting siding can compromise the integrity of a building’s exterior, leading to increased energy costs and potential structural damage. Fading or peeling paint, along with visible signs of wear, may also indicate that the existing siding is no longer functioning effectively. In some cases, homeowners notice increased drafts or moisture in the walls, which can be mitigated with a siding upgrade. The overview below groups typical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Swansea,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or siding repairs or replacements for small sections typ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ering basic fixes or partial replacements.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this amount but are less common.
Mid-Size Projects - replacing or upgrading siding on an average-sized home usually ranges from $3,000 to $7,000. Most local contractors handle projects in this band, which include full replacement of siding on a standard home.
Full Home Replacement - complete siding replacement for larger or more intricate homes can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ects often involve additional preparation or custom materials, which can push costs higher.
High-End or Complex Installations - specialty materials, custom designs, or homes with unique architectural features can lead to costs exceeding $20,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ve detailed work or premium siding options.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ear and detailed written expectations are essential to a successful siding replacement. Pros should be able to provide a comprehensive scope of work that outlines the materials, methods, and steps involved in the project. This helps homeowners understand exactly what will be done and sets a foundation for transparent communication. When comparing local contractors, it’s beneficial to ask for written estimates or proposals that specify the work involved, rather than relying solely on verbal assurances. This clarity can prevent misunderstandings and ensure that everyone is aligned on the project’s goals.
